Shiver along with the D.C. Chapter, FReepers from across the country, other patriotic Americans and Iraqi exiles as C-SPAN broadcasts the Patriots Rally For America IV today at 1:05 p.m.

Recorded yesterday at the cold, fog-shrouded, snow-covered grounds of the Washington Monument, the rally held to support our troops, President Bush and the American policy on Iraq features former Rep. Bob Dornan, Aziz Al-Taee, Blanquita Cullum, John Armor, James Parmelee, Kevin Martin, Adam Ramey and yours truly.

Also featured are singers Cullen Martin, Stephanie Souders and, from Nashville, Lowell Shyette.

The program, if shown in it's entirety, should run three hours and fifteen minutes.

Actually, I disagree that a specific goal is sufficient to succeed. Many youngsters in law school have the specific goal of being a federal judge. But there are a limited number of those fancy appellate clerkships and most don't get 'em. And that's when they fall off the fast track -- shortly after graduation. It's a brutual, abrupt division of paths. They then have no hope then of getting feeder jobs for judgeships, such as being Ass't U.S. Attorneys or the like.

Also, I know many judges who view the trial lawyers as having more say in how a case turns out: they're the ones that develop the evidence and shape the issues. Especially at the district court level, it can be frustrating being a judge, seeing a lawyer kill his or her own case by mistake or miss an opportunity. Ideally, the judge is just the ump. Some times I wonder why people aspire to judgeships other than for esteem issues such was wanting the "trappings of power." That post about "I'm going to be a judge and then you'll all be grateful to me" from that fellow sounded like that to me. My advice to a young would-be lawyer would be to seek out ways to acquire *real* power -- to make a real difference in the real world -- and not the trappings of power.
